Linux怎样引入cmake命令

worktile 其他 116

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ux中引入cmake命令,需要按照以下步骤进行操作:

    1. 安装cmake:首先,需要确保系统中已经安装了cmake。如果尚未安装,可以通过包管理器来安装,比如在Ubuntu中可以使用以下命令:
    “`
    sudo apt install cmake
    “`
    如果使用的是其他Linux发行版,请根据相应的包管理器进行安装。

    2. 验证cmake安装:安装完成后,可以通过以下命令验证cmake是否安装成功:
    “`
    cmake –version
    “`
    如果安装成功,将显示相应的cmake版本信息。

    3. 创建CMakeLists.txt:在项目的根目录下创建一个名为CMakeLists.txt的文件。这个文件用来定义项目的构建规则。

    4. 编写CMakeLists.txt:打开CMakeLists.txt文件,使用文本编辑器编写构建规则。构建规则是使用cmake指令编写的一系列命令,用于描述项目的编译、链接等过程。具体的编写方式和规则根据项目的需求而定。

    5. 运行cmake命令:在项目根目录下打开终端,运行以下命令来生成构建文件:
    “`
    cmake .
    “`
    这会在当前目录下生成一个默认的构建文件,用于后续的项目构建。

    6. 构建项目:运行以下命令来构建项目:
    “`
    make
    “`
    这将根据CMakeLists.txt文件中的规则进行项目的编译、链接等操作。

    7. 运行项目:完成项目构建后,可以使用以下命令来运行项目:
    “`
    ./ “`
    其中,`
    `为生成的可执行文件名。

    通过上述步骤,可以成功引入cmake命令,并使用cmake来管理和构建项目。当然,具体的使用和配置还根据项目的要求和需求进行进一步的操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在Linux系统中引入cmake命令,可以按照以下步骤进行操作:

    1. 在Linux系统中,打开终端窗口。
    2. 检查系统是否已经安装了cmake。可以通过在终端中输入以下命令进行检查:
    “`
    cmake –version
    “`
    如果已经安装了cmake,将显示cmake的版本信息。否则,终端会提示找不到该命令。

    3. 如果没有安装cmake,可以使用包管理器来安装。不同的Linux发行版使用的包管理器可能不同,以下是一些常见的包管理器及其对应的命令:
    – Debian/Ubuntu:使用apt-get命令进行安装。
    “`
    sudo apt-get update
    sudo apt-get install cmake
    “`
    – CentOS/Fedora/RHEL:使用yum命令进行安装。
    “`
    sudo yum install cmake
    “`
    – Arch Linux:使用pacman命令进行安装。
    “`
    sudo pacman -S cmake
    “`

    4. 执行安装命令后,系统将自动下载并安装cmake。安装完成后,可以再次输入命令`cmake –version`来确认cmake是否已经安装成功。

    5. 如果以上步骤都没有成功安装cmake,也可以手动下载cmake的源代码并进行编译安装。以下是手动安装cmake的一般步骤:
    – 在cmake的官方网站(https://cmake.org/download/)下载cmake的源代码压缩包。
    – 解压缩下载的压缩包,并进入解压后的目录。
    – 使用以下命令进行配置、编译和安装:
    “`
    ./bootstrap
    make
    sudo make install
    “`

    6. 安装完成后,可以在终端窗口中使用cmake命令来运行cmake相关的任务,如编译软件源代码、生成Makefile等。

    总结起来,要在Linux系统中引入cmake命令,可以通过包管理器安装cmake,或手动下载源代码进行编译安装。安装完成后,即可在终端中使用cmake命令来执行相应任务。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,通过以下步骤来引入cmake命令:

    步骤一:安装CMake
    1. 打开终端。
    2. 输入命令sudo apt-get update并按回车键,更新软件包列表。
    3. 输入命令sudo apt-get install cmake并按回车键,开始安装CMake。
    4. 系统会提示是否继续安装,输入“y”并按回车键。

    步骤二:验证CMake是否安装成功
    1. 输入命令cmake –version并按回车键。
    2. 如果显示了CMake的版本信息,则表示安装成功。

    步骤三:运行CMake命令
    1. 在终端中进入需要使用CMake的项目文件夹。
    2. 创建一个build文件夹,用于存放编译生成的文件。可以使用命令mkdir build来创建该文件夹。
    3. 进入build文件夹,使用cd build命令。
    4. 在build文件夹中运行CMake命令。例如,输入cmake ..并按回车键。这里的“..”表示上层目录,可以根据需要修改为项目所在的路径。
    5. CMake会根据项目中的CMakeLists.txt文件来生成Makefile或其他构建系统所需的文件。
    6. 在build文件夹中运行make命令进行编译。例如,输入make并按回车键。
    7. 编译完成后,可在build文件夹下找到生成的可执行文件或其他所需的文件。

    通过上述步骤,您可以成功引入cmake命令并在Linux系统中使用。请注意,不同的项目可能需要不同的CMakeLists.txt文件或参数设置,在使用CMake之前,可以先阅读项目的相关文档或说明来了解其具体使用方法。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部